Bitcoin Influence Collective Launch Fuels Speculative Surge
The catalyst is unequivocal: DDC’s announcement of the Bitcoin Influence Collective (BIC) has unlocked speculative buying. The initiative unites four crypto luminaries—Adrian Morris, Lemar Ashhar, Magdalena Gronowska, and TimTIMB-- Kotzman—to amplify DDC’s corporate bitcoin treasury strategy. This coalition directly aligns with DDC’s mission to institutionalize bitcoin as a core reserve asset, resonating with traders betting on its potential to capitalize on digital assetDAAQ-- adoption. Backtest DDC Enterprise Stock Performance
The backtest of DDC's performance after an intraday surge of 45% shows mixed results. While the stock experienced a maximum return of 1.48% on the 14th day following the surge, the overall short-term performance was lackluster, with a -1.65% return on the third day and a -0.74% return on the tenth day. The win rates for the 3-Day, 10-Day, and 30-Day periods were 39.16%, 40.36%, and 41.57%, respectively, indicating that while there was a decent chance of positive returns in the short term, the actual returns were not as favorable as the win rates would suggest.
